A New Generation of MLM

By: Cathy Yeatts

Whether you're familiar with the term 'MLM' or not, you are most assuredly familiar with the business model. Was your neighbor down the street an Avon lady, or did your mother sell Pampered Chef? Or are you one of the millions of women who have had a Mary Kay makeover. Then you are familiar with MLM. Today, the popularity of MLM companies has doubled what it was even ten years ago, and the catalogues for Tastefully Simple, Pampered Chef and Avon abound at offices everywhere.

While I flip through the catalogues at my office, I always wonder, "How is Direct Sales working out for these people?" Is the Mary Kay Consultant one recruit away from her free car? Is the Pampered Chef Representative rolling in dough, or wishing he hadn't gotten involved?

Traditionally, there was only one kind of person who could succeed at direct sales. You know the type: a born salesperson, extremely forward, charismatic and more than slightly pushy. Anyone who didn't possess those characteristics in exactly the right order and quantities failed, failed quickly, and more importantly, failed with a grudge against mlm's of all kinds.

It's a shame that the true virtues of mlm are hidden under the stigmas of traditional marketing tactics. Who doesn't want to work from home? Who doesn't want to supplement his or her income without having to deal with a schedule and wages someone else decided on? Who doesn't want to be a part of a company they really believe in? Yet many don't, because of previous bad experiences with mlm.

The truth is, MLM can be great source of residual income, if it is gone about in the right way. And it doesn't have to take the kind of person I mentioned earlier. Advances in technology have opened new ways to achieve success in network marketing so different from traditional methods they've turned the stigma-tattooed industry upside down!

Using the Internet, network marketers can now attract prospects to them, by offering a real value in informative web content before ever trying to sell anything to anyone. There is a whole big world out there that can be reached using the web, a big world that can provide you with residual income.

That makes the idea of prospecting in your cul-de-sac neighborhood seem asinine, doesn't it? That's because your neighborhood, your local grocery store, your office, or even your whole town, are ultimately limited markets. You may make income, but it won't be residual income. Your home business will eventually reach a plateau.

With Internet network marketing, your field is global, your stream of prospects (and thus, your income) endless. Better yet, with the new mode of network marketing, you are not spending your valuable time and energy chasing down prospects. The Internet is searcher-oriented. That' why every Internet experience you've ever had began with a search engine box. Those who find your home-based business on the web will do so because they have searched for it.

Attraction marketing makes the marketer a sought-after commodity. No more blind pursuit, no more endless warming up of indifferent leads. With attraction marketing, the work is almost done by the time you begin contact with leads. You can choose the most highly qualified to work with, and yes, you decide how much money you earn. After it's begun, this state of being pursued perpetuates itself. Everyone wants to wear the most popular labels. It's written into the Law of Attraction.

There are so many pros to this system. Traditional mlm businesses had a lot of trouble getting off the ground, because the distributors were running at a zero balance all the time. With Internet network marketing, distributor's can monetize their website by selling advertising space, or by partnering with a like company to promote their products for a commission. Advertising can be free while the business is getting started, because there are many good forms of free advertising on the web, such as Ezine Articles, or YouTube. The business earns its keep and the distributors are neither frantic nor dejected.

That's a long way from the indignity associated with Direct Sales in our mothers' day. Network marketers today have established themselves as valuable commodities, experts in their respective fields, and they have utilitized the Internet to build profitable businesses and substantial income!
